So, Antonio and Laylo play in PSC rapid open
abs-cbnNEWS.com 02/26/2010 6:17 PM

MANILA, Philippines – Grandmasters (GMs) Wesley So, Rogelio “Joey” Antonio Jr. and Darwin Laylo are joining the best and the brightest in local chess in the “All in Sports-Expo 2010” Open rapid chess championship on Saturday at the Philippine Sports Commission (PSC), Rizal Memorial Sports Complex in Manila.

So, Antonio and Laylo, who represented the country in last year’s World Chess Cup, will vie for the top prize of P30,000 plus the coveted championships’ trophy.

“With most of the country’s top players competing, we expect another battle royale in the two day competition,” said National Chess Federation of the Philippines (NCFP) president Prospero “Butch” Pichay Jr.

Pichay will be gracing the opening ceremony at 11 am together with NCFP secretary-general and Tagaytay City mayor Abraham “Bambol” Tolentino Jr., PSC chairman Harry Angping, Asia’s First GM Eugene Torre and other top PSC and NCFP officials.

Also joining the action in the tournament are GMs John Paul Gomez, Mark Paragua, Jayson Gonzales and Buenaventura “Bong” Villamayor; International Masters Rolando Nolte, Barlo Nadera and Chito Garma; FIDE Masters Christopher Castellano, David Elorta, Deniel Causo and Leonardo Carlos; National Masters Haridas Pascua, Julius Joseph de Ramos, Ali Branzuela, Mirabeau Maga, Efren Bagamasbad, Andrew Vasquez; and 7-time executive grand champion Dr. Jenny Mayor among others.

Tournament director is NCFP executive director and event manager Wilfredo “Willie” Abalos.
